Key Takeaways
The serial number for an ECHO PB-200 can typically be found on a metal plate or sticker located on the engine housing or recoil starter assembly of the leaf blower. In some models, it may also be located on the frame or handle of the unit. If you are unable to locate the serial number in these areas, refer to the product manual for more detailed instructions.

Identifying The Serial Number Location

To locate the serial number for your ECHO PB 200, start by checking the main body of the leaf blower. Typically, the serial number can be found engraved on a metal plate or sticker directly on the body of the machine. Look for any identification labels or tags that contain a combination of numbers and letters specific to your PB 200 model.

If the serial number is not visible on the main body, inspect the engine housing or near the handle of the leaf blower. Some models may have the serial number imprinted on these parts for easy reference. Take your time to thoroughly examine all exterior surfaces of the PB 200 to ensure no serial number location goes unnoticed.

In case you are unable to locate the serial number on the leaf blower itself, refer to the user manual or documentation that came with your ECHO PB 200. Manufacturers often include information on where to find the serial number and its format in the user guide. Utilize these resources to successfully identify the serial number for your ECHO PB 200.

Where Can I Find The Serial Number On My Echo Pb 200?

The serial number of your ECHO PB-200 can be found on the blower’s engine housing. Look for a sticker or plate that displays the model number and serial number information. It is usually located near the fuel tank or on the side of the engine. If you’re having trouble locating it, consult the user manual for specific instructions or contact ECHO customer service for assistance. Keeping track of the serial number is important for warranty and maintenance purposes.
